Preparing for Ramazan

Published
Ramazan is an Islamic religious observance that takes place during the ninth month of the Islamic calendar; the month in which the Quran was revealed to the Prophet Muhammad. In this Islamic month of fasting, Muslims abstain from eating, drinking indulging in anything that is in excess or ill-natured; from dawn until sunset. Fasting is meant to teach the Muslim patience, modesty and spirituality.
